Case Example: Service + Journey + Material

Practical example: bill service, journey and material together in one order.

Written by Philipp Geimer

In this article you learn how to create a maintenance cleaning order — such as a household cleaning — and have a digital work receipt countersigned at the end.

Step 1: Create the Order

  1. Start the order: Select a customer and an object.

  2. Set the start date: Start from this month and click "Next".

Step 2: Add Services

  1. Select household cleaning: Add the service "Household cleaning".

  2. Billing: If no further services are required, proceed to billing.

Step 3: Define Billing

  1. Service: Set "Household cleaning" to one-time monthly billing.

  2. Journey: Add the journey per operation and group it.

  3. Material usage: Define material usage with a flat rate of 50 euros.

Step 4: Create Shifts

  1. Create shift: Select the services and set the start date.

  2. Set time: For example, Fridays from 10:00 to 12:30.

  3. Service receipt: Enable automatic creation of the service receipt.

Step 5: Add Employees

  1. Select employee: Add an employee and specify when they are available.

  2. Shift assignment: Confirm the employee's assignment to the shift.
